North Dakota Capitol Notebook:
Safe school bill dies

By Janell Cole
The Forum - March 21, 2003

The Senate changed its mind Thursday on a bill designed to prevent discrimination against school students by other students or teachers.

Senate Bill 2216, which passed the Senate last month, 27-20, came back for another vote Thursday after the House amended it.

This time, the Senate killed the bill, 25-16, mostly along party lines. Two Republican senators who joined the Democratic caucus in voting for it again were Ray Holmberg of Grand Forks and Tim Flakoll of Fargo.
